4.20 Restart Inhibit for Motors (ANSI 66, 49Rotor)
Setting Ranges / Increments
Restart Threshold
Restart Times
Motor starting current relative to Nominal
Motor Current
I
Start
/I
Motor Nom
1.5 to 10.0 Increments 0.1
Max. admissible Startup Time
T
Start Max
3.0 s to 120.0 s Increments 1 s
Leveling Time
T
LEVEL
0.0 min to 60.0 min Increments 0.1 min
Maximum admissible Number of Warm Starts
n
WARM
1 to 4 Increments 1
Difference between Cold and Warm Starts
n
Cold
– n
Warm
1 to 2 Increments 1
Extension Factor at Standstill
k
τ STANDSTILL
1.0 to 100.0 Increments 0.1
Extension Factor on Motor Operation
k
τ OPERATION
1.0 to 100.0 Increments 0.1
Minimum Restart Inhibit Time 0.2 to 120.0 min Increm. 0.1 min
